Main Event Analysis: Bantamweight Showdown
Kasey “Las Vegas” Tanner vs. Michael “The Mullet” Cyr
The bantamweight main event features two equally matched prospects with identical 8-1 records, both seeking to establish themselves as the next breakout star in the 135-pound division.
Kasey “Las Vegas” Tanner (8-1)
Age: 27 | Team: Fight Ready MMA & Fitness
Key Strengths:
• Home field advantage fighting in Arizona
• Dana White’s Contender Series veteran with UFC experience
• Elite training environment with Henry Cejudo and Fight Ready
• Well-rounded skill set with multiple finishing methods
• Back-to-back LFA wins including recent submission victory
Points of Concern:
• DWCS loss to Jean Matsumoto showed vulnerabilities
• Pressure of hometown expectations
• Coming off decision loss in biggest opportunity
Michael “The Mullet” Cyr (8-1)
Team: Warrior Camp | Location: Spokane, Washington
Key Strengths:
• Dangerous submission specialist (88% finish rate by submission)
• First LFA main event opportunity – nothing to lose
• Precise striking technique and cage composure
• Proven finishing ability with 7 submission victories
• Momentum and confidence entering biggest fight
Points of Concern:
• Fighting away from home base
• Less experience on big stages
• Facing opponent with UFC-level experience
Fight Breakdown
Tanner’s Path to Victory: Utilize his striking experience and home crowd energy to control the distance early. Avoid getting drawn into Cyr’s grappling exchanges and capitalize on his Fight Ready training to implement a disciplined game plan.
Cyr’s Path to Victory: Press forward with his grappling advantages and look to get the fight to the ground where his elite submission skills can shine. Mix in clean striking to set up takedown opportunities and avoid prolonged striking exchanges.
Main Event Prediction
Expect a technical battle between two hungry prospects. Cyr’s submission prowess could be the deciding factor, but Tanner’s experience advantage and home field make this a true pick ’em fight. Look for Cyr to secure a late submission or Tanner to win a close decision in what should be a fight of the night candidate.
